
Deadly force
Paul E. Schenck suffered from bipolar disorder, alcoholism and owned numerous guns. He called 911 after getting in a fight with his son. When police encountered Schenck, he refused to come out of his room. Schenck fired several shots inside the room, and police withdrew to form a perimeter. Police requested assistance from the Greene County Combined SWAT Team. They soon received aid from about 63 units from 10 jurisdictions in the area. Schenck fired hundreds of rounds from multiple guns during the hours long standoff, most of them at the inside of the dwelling. A SWAT sniper short and killed Schenck to end the standoff.
